Conference Objectives

HACU’s Annual Conference provides a unique forum for the sharing of
information and ideas for the best and most promising practices in the
education of Hispanics. The conference goals are to:

- showcase successful, effective, and exemplary programs and initiatives of
HACU member institutions

- promote and expand partnerships and strategic alliances for collaboration
between HACU member institutions and public- and private-sector
organizations

- foster and identify graduate education opportunities for Hispanic students
and graduates

- deliberate policy issues affecting the education opportunities of Hispanics,
including HACU’s legislative agenda

- promote greater Hispanic participation in scholarships, fellowships,
internships and other such programs funded by private and government
organizations

- increase HSI and Hispanic awareness and readiness to participate in
foundation-supported programs

- discuss emerging trends in higher education affecting Hispanics and HSIs,
e.g., distance learning, student-centered learning, outcomes assessment, and
cross-national accreditation
